Amazing opportunity to pioneer your own version of excellence in animal care in the Lowcountry of South Carolina.  We are seeking an enthusiastic Veterinarian who enjoys surgery and dentistry to lead our community-based practice. Veterinary Medical Center of Hardeeville is a new clinic, positioned in a busy shopping center with high visibility, efficiently designed to meet the needs of our team, our patients and their owners.  We are a privately owned; our sole focus is pet healthcare – no boarding, no grooming, no retail.  Our goal is to provide excellent customer service, client education and compassionate care, with no corporate interference.

Responsibilities:

  • Practice in accordance with state practice act and principles of veterinary medical ethics
  • Use evidence-based medicine and continued pursuit of education to deliver quality patient
  • Devote yourself to the culture of preventive care.
  • Deliver medical and surgical treatments with approved pharmaceuticals, supplies and equipment.
  • Partner with clients as an advocate for the pet to plan follow-up visits, provide homecare instructions and education to ensure the lifelong health of their pets.
  • Maintain relevant, comprehensive electronic medical records with the support of practice system, AVIMARK
  • Build and lead an effective veterinary team by communicating medical standards, ethical practices and sharing your veterinary knowledge & experience.

Requirements:

  • State Veterinary Board License (able to obtain South Carolina if not already licensed)
  • State Controlled Substance License (able to obtain South Carolina if not already licensed)
  • DEA License
